Essential Job Functions
Asset Management:
  • Ensure that logistical support is delivered to multiple hubs in different geographical areas in Borno.
  • Ensures that procedures outlined in the Mercy Corps Asset Management Manual will be implemented in Mercy Corps Offices.
  • Advises colleagues on guidelines of Mercy Corps asset and equipment use guidelines.
  • Ensures all lost, damage, sold, stolen (or other) items are properly recorded in with an approved Disposal of Assets form. Ensure any necessary, supplement documentation is completed;
  • Advises supervisor on any broken, damaged or destroyed equipment;
  • Ensures that all movement of items should go through the Logs, on “GRNs or an Asset Movement Form”.
  • Assists and coordinate project staff on inventory issues. Assist in providing end of project reports on inventory and equipment lists, locations and status;
  • Maintain inventories of all Mercy Corps premises (non-expendable properties) conduct regular checks (quarterly).
  • Responsible for logging all new Mercy Corps assets in the asset register and ensuring the appropriate coding and tags are placed on each item. Regularly updates asset register with changes and new acquisitions;;
  • Responsible for coordinating with the procurement and finance office in identifying all details of assets such as buying price, ledger reference, PR, PO and GRN number etc. The asset register should be accurate and complete;
  • Responsible to maintain the stock of Mercy Corps assets that are not checked out and in use;
  • Responsible for checking in/out Mercy Corps owned equipment to authorized staff using the standard Mercy Corps procedures and forms outlined in the Asset Management Manual;
  • Responsible for the timely preparation of documentation of any movement of assets in Mercy Corps formats;
  • Schedules and conducts physical count of assets on different locations, projects and sites;
  • Provides a monthly physical count/check where all assets are located and their status confirmed; coordinate with the responsible officer for tracking assets in other offices to ensure the locations and status of assets that have moved between offices;
  • Updates the electronic database monthly and provides an electronic copy to Operations Manager; A hard copy is printed, signed and filed in the assets folder;
Transport Management:
  • Responsible for oversight of vehicle rentals including tracking of service agreements and payments.
  • Ensures trip tickets are used by program staff and approved by necessary persons.
  • Administrates movement of sat phones, ensuring phones are always charged and operational
  • Maintains vehicle movement board daily.
  • Oversees and ensures proper use of the vehicles.
  • Oversees fuel consumption and tracking; prepares fuel reimbursement payments
  • Participate in disciplinary measures for drivers.
  • Coordinate with communications department to ensure regular vehicle communications.
  • Ensure that security incident reports are completed and filed (if related to vehicles).
  • Ensure that accident reports are completed and filed.
  • Ensures that all vehicles are safe and road-worthy.
  • Ensures that all vehicles have proper on-board vehicle documentation.
  • Maintains administrative vehicle files for each vehicle.
  • Continuous tracking of vehicle log-sheets; responsible for monthly compilation and submission of log-sheets.
  • Coordinates weekly movement plans and schedules vehicle use to meet programmatic and operational needs.
  • Booking UNHAS flights to different MC filed offices.
